Beauty and the Beast is one of the most popular classic tales ever written. A beautiful young woman dreams of meeting a handsome prince, but to save her father’s life, she leaves home to live with a terrible, frightening beast. Though her patron is hideous, his disarming generosity slowly leads to asurprising connection. Generations of children have been fascinated by the story of the girl named Beauty, who grows to love a fearsome beast by learning to see and cherish his kindness, generosity, and intelligence.
